How do you view the quota issue when it concerns private universities?
 
With quotas being implemented in all government-aided institutions, it's not necessary the same should be brought into play in private institutions. They have been given independence and hence the quota implementation should be made as their own call. But I think that since these private varsities have been given the freedom to function as per the standards set by them, they need to comply to certain rules set by the government. However, implementation of the quota system should not be made mandatory and they should be allowed to make a call for themselves which would give them a clearer picture and understanding as to what is best for them.

                                                                            
"� Ekta Mody, 1st year, MBA, NMIMS
 
It looks as if quotas are mandalisation of educational institutions since the quotas are not based on assessment of effectiveness; they are incompatible with the freedom and diversity of institutions; and they politicise the education process. However, if introduced and implemented effectively, quotas can help in achieving the original cause of introducing them "� upliftment of the socially and educationally-backward classes. The agreement between government and private universities is a good initiative considering the current scenario. The initiative taken by private varsities is a step forward in the right direction.

"� Dinesh Kataria, 1st year, MBA, NMIMS
